A pair of Amarillo College students learned a great deal more about mosquitoes this summer than they ever thought they might.
They owe it all to the City of Amarillo, AC’s amply equipped STEM Research Center and, yes, a fortuitous reduction in local bus service.
Marcus Baber-Newton and Dustan Francis took part in a special research project in which the College and the City of Amarillo’s Environmental Health Department collaborated to discern if locally captured mosquitoes carried harmful diseases.
